How long does it take to get dentures made in Vietnam?

Getting dentures in Vietnam typically takes 3 to 7 days for straightforward cases. More complex procedures, including immediate dentures or those requiring extractions, generally take 1 to 2 weeks. High-end clinics in Ho Chi Minh City use in-house labs to accelerate fabrication times for international patients.

  • Conventional dentures: Simple removable prosthetics usually require 3 to 5 days for final delivery.
  • Immediate dentures: Temporary sets are often prepared within 24 hours of initial dental impressions.
  • In-house fabrication: On-site laboratories at facilities like Worldwide Dental Hospital significantly reduce turnaround times.
  • Adjustment period: Patients should allow 2 to 3 days for post-fitting bite alignment tweaks.

How long do I need to stay in the country after my dentures are fitted?

You should stay in Vietnam for 3 to 14 days after your dentures are fitted to ensure proper healing and adjustment. This timeframe allows your dentist to monitor for sore spots, perform essential bite corrections, and confirm the prosthetic functions comfortably during eating and speaking.

  • Standard dentures stay: Plan for 3 to 5 days for testing and immediate sore spot modifications.
  • Immediate dentures stay: Stay 7 to 10 days for swelling management and potential stitch removal.
  • Implant-supported dentures: Requires 7 to 14 days to monitor surgical wounds and final bridge fit.
  • Mandatory 24-hour checkup: Patients receiving immediate dentures must visit the clinic the following day for cleaning.

Do I need a specific visa for dental tourism in Vietnam?

Vietnam does not require a specific dental visa for international patients. You can enter the country using a standard e-Visa or traditional tourist visa. Most patients apply for a 90-day e-Visa, which allows for single or multiple entries depending on your denture treatment plan.

  • Visa validity: The standard Vietnam e-Visa remains valid for up to 90 days.
  • Multi-stage procedures: Multiple-entry visas allow you to leave and return for final fittings.
  • Application time: Processing usually takes 3 to 5 business days for most international travelers.
  • Passport requirements: Ensure your passport is valid for 6 months beyond your arrival date.
